Possible Causes of Water Damage in Charleston
One of the leading causes of water damage in Charleston is severe weather. Heavy rainstorms and hurricanes frequently impact the area, leading to floodwaters infiltrating homes and businesses. Unfortunately, many structures are not designed to withstand such water intrusion, resulting in hidden and visible damage. Poor drainage systems and clogged gutters can also exacerbate water pooling around the foundation, eventually seeping inside your property.
Another common cause is plumbing failures. Burst pipes or leaking appliances such as washing machines or water heaters can cause significant water intrusion if not caught early. Aging plumbing systems are especially vulnerable, and neglecting regular inspections can lead to unnoticed leaks. These issues can escalate quickly, causing structural damage and fostering mold growth if not addressed swiftly by professionals.
How Can We Fix Water Damage?
Our experts begin by assessing the extent of the water damage using advanced tools and technology. This allows us to identify hidden moisture behind walls, within flooring, and beneath structural components. Once we understand the scope, we proceed with water extraction to remove standing water efficiently.
After extracting water, we focus on thorough drying and dehumidification. Using industrial-grade equipment, our team ensures all affected areas are completely dry, which is essential to prevent mold growth. We also clean and sanitize surfaces to eliminate bacteria, germs, and unpleasant odors caused by standing water.
Finally, we offer reconstruction and repair services to restore your property to its original condition. This includes drywall replacement, flooring repairs, and any structural enhancements needed to prevent future water issues. Can water damage cause mold growth?
Yes, if not treated promptly, moisture from water damage can lead to mold growth within 24-48 hours. Our restoration services include thorough mold prevention measures to protect your health and property.
How can I prevent water damage in the future?
Regular maintenance of plumbing systems, gutter cleaning, and installing sump pumps can reduce risk. Additionally, monitoring weather alerts and preparing your property for storms can help prevent unexpected water intrusion.
